A Huge Number of People Starved to Death After Elon Musk Cut USAID's Funding
"In the weeks following the second inauguration of Donald Trump, billionaire Elon Musk - appointed to a powerful position in the government after supporting Trump's run -began laying waste to a number of government agencies with the help of his so-called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E). One major target in his crosshairs was USAID, an international development agency that has historically distributed billions of dollars inaid across the world."
"The United States was the program's largest donor by a significant margin, contributing $4.45 billion last year. Funding cuts have been devastating for the WFP's lifesaving programs ever since. Around 720,000 refugees in Kenya relied on the organization to survive. But without foreign aid from the US, the WFP was forced to cut rations dramatically, trapping over 300,000 people in the Kakuma refugee camp in northern Kenya - one of the largest in the world - with almost nothing to eat."
